2. | ACCOUNTING POLICIES |
|
Basis of preparing the financial statements |
|
|
Turnover |
Turnover is measured at the fair value of the consideration received or receivable, excluding discounts, rebates, |
value added tax and other sales taxes. |
|
Intangible assets |
Intangible assets includes the purchase of IP addresses which are currently be valued at the market rate, with any |
future revaluation being charged/credited to the profit and loss account. |
|
Taxation |
Taxation for the period comprises current and deferred tax. Tax is recognised in the Income Statement, except to |
the extent that it relates to items recognised in other comprehensive income or directly in equity. |
|
Current or deferred taxation assets and liabilities are not discounted. |
|
Current tax is recognised at the amount of tax payable using the tax rates and laws that have been enacted or |
substantively enacted by the balance sheet date. |
|
Deferred tax |
Deferred tax is recognised in respect of all timing differences that have originated but not reversed at the balance |
sheet date. |
|
Timing differences arise from the inclusion of income and expenses in tax assessments in periods different from |
those in which they are recognised in financial statements. Deferred tax is measured using tax rates and laws that |
have been enacted or substantively enacted by the period end and that are expected to apply to the reversal of the |
timing difference. |
|
Unrelieved tax losses and other deferred tax assets are recognised only to the extent that it is probable that they |
will be recovered against the reversal of deferred tax liabilities or other future taxable profits. |
